History about Putung is almost unknown since there is no. manuscript ever left. However, the elderly told that long time ago this area belonged to Manggis traditional village. An epidemic spread up once upon a time, when a lot of peole lost their lives and no one cared about the neglected dead bodies. At a village named Bakung a corpse was found decaying and considered to make the village “leteh” (besmirched).
Karangasem Grand Palace was built by the first King of Karangasem, Anak Agung Cede Jelantik by the end of the nineteenth century.The major attraction of the Grand Palace is its architecture, a combination between Balinese, Chinese and European.The characteristic of Balinese architecture can be seen from the reliefs on the entrance gate, the statues and on the wall while European influence can be seen from the design of the main building and very vast veranda called “maskerdam”.

Taman Sari Temple is located or the North east of Semarapura or about 500 meters from the town centre. The beauty of this temple is seen from the emerging of th( eleven and nine storey roofedshrines (merus) from the pond Eleven storey-roofed shrine for the Hindus, symbolizing Mount Mahameru standing on a giant turtle, drowned in milky ocean.Then came the Deities and demons to stir the mountain with Anantaboga dragon to be the rope winder. From the process ostirring the milky ocean then came up “Amerta” holy water (water of life).

Tihingan village is located at Banjarangkan District Klungkung regency (3 km west of Semarapura).The village car be reached easily by motor vehicle (two-wheeled and four wheeled ) through asphalted road.
Tihingan village belonging to Banjarangkan District is known as the centre of “Gamelan” makers. “Gamelan Gong” making process involves hard workers as well as special experts to pitch the “gamelan” tone, so special skill is very much needed for this work.
